Transaction 501927294cdd157b5856b1cba60c3f5d230d2a421c61129fda7b06eb882a8a1e

1 Input
2 Outputs
  • 501927294cdd157b5856b1cba60c3f5d230d2a421c61129fda7b06eb882a8a1e:0
  • value  1276980
    address  1EPF8tzKgpMRGKU8YoY5GupphHkUukdsFX
  • 501927294cdd157b5856b1cba60c3f5d230d2a421c61129fda7b06eb882a8a1e:1
  • value  3789014
    address  13YEVXUZEmr4egrNYsWqzQKnMY54Qj9F8h